Marine engines generate vibration and dynamic forces that can be transmitted to the vessel structure through their mounting points. A correctly designed vibration isolation system reduces this transmission whilst maintaining the stability of the propulsion unit under different operating conditions.
AMC MECANOCAUCHO offers a dedicated range of anti-vibration mounts for marine applications, including the Marine, Marine X, Marine XD, Marine XT, Marine V, Marine VD, BRB and BSB ranges, designed for the elastic mounting of propulsion engines, generator sets and auxiliary equipment.
Mount selection depends on factors including engine mass, load distribution, excitation frequency, installation configuration and the dynamic forces acting on the system.
Correct selection provides an optimum balance between vibration isolation, engine stability and movement control, whilst reducing the loads transmitted to associated equipment and the vessel structure.
